The Smithtown Count was held on Friday, December 27 and we tallied 105
species.
The highlights included:
1 Eurasian Widgeon
149 Common Mergansers
1 Red-necked Grebe
21 Northern Gannet
1 Merlin
1 Peregrine Falcon
14 Wild Turkey
2 Clapper Rail
3 Greater Yellowlegs
9 Purple Sandpipers

Cupsogue was very quiet birdwise - though there was a Snowy Owl in the
vicinity. An additional bird was picked up near the other end of Dune Rd.
There were several long-tailed ducks at the Ponqogue bridge, visible from
the southern fishing pier and Shinnecock Inlet had quite a few Loons.
